ATLANTA, Nov. 12, 2019 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Cardlytics, Inc. CDLX, a purchase intelligence platform that makes marketing more relevant and measurable, today announced financial results for the third quarter ended September 30, 2019. Third Quarter 2019 Financial Results

  • Revenue was $56.4 million, an increase of 63% year-over-year, compared to $34.6 million in the third quarter of 2018.
  • Net loss attributable to common stockholders was $(7.7) million, or $(0.33) per diluted share, based on 23.6 million weighted-average common shares outstanding, compared to a net loss attributable to common stockholders of $(8.4) million, or $(0.40) per diluted share, based on 21.0 million weighted-average common shares outstanding in the third quarter of 2018.
  • Non-GAAP net income was $0.8 million, or $0.03 per diluted share, based on 23.6 million non-GAAP weighted-average common shares outstanding, compared to a non-GAAP net loss of $(3.1) million, or $(0.15) per diluted share, based on 21.0 million non-GAAP weighted-average common shares outstanding in the third quarter of 2018.
  • Billings, a non-GAAP metric, was $82.8 million, an increase of 70% year-over-year, compared to $48.6 million in the third quarter of 2018.
  • Adjusted contribution, a non-GAAP metric, was $24.7 million, an increase of 46% year-over-year, compared to $17.0 million in the third quarter of 2018. During the third quarter of 2018, adjusted contribution and adjusted EBITDA included the impact of a non-cash gain totaling $0.8 million related to the renewal of our agreement with Lloyds.
  • Adjusted EBITDA, a non-GAAP metric, was a gain of $3.0 million compared to a loss of $(1.7) million in the third quarter of 2018.

Key Metrics

  • FI MAUs were 128.3 million, an increase of 116%, compared to 59.3 million in the third quarter of 2018.
  • ARPU was $0.44, a decrease of (24)%, compared to $0.58 in the third quarter of 2018.

Definitions of FI MAUs and ARPU are included below under the caption "Non-GAAP Measures and Other Performance Metrics."

About Cardlytics

Cardlytics CDLX uses purchase intelligence to make marketing more relevant and measurable. We partner with financial institutions to run their banking rewards programs that promote customer loyalty and deepen banking relationships. In turn, we have a secure view into where and when consumers are spending their money. We use these insights to help marketers identify, reach, and influence likely buyers at scale, as well as measure the true sales impact of marketing campaigns. Headquartered in Atlanta, Cardlytics has offices in London, New York, San Francisco and Visakhapatnam. Learn more at www.cardlytics.com.

Non-GAAP Measures and Other Performance Metrics

To supplement the financial measures presented in our press release and related conference call or webcast in accordance with generally accepted accounting principles in the United States ("GAAP"), we also present the following non-GAAP measures of financial performance: billings, adjusted contribution, adjusted EBITDA, adjusted FI Share and other third party costs, non-GAAP net income (loss) and non-GAAP income (loss) per share as well as certain other performance metrics, such as FI monthly active users ("FI MAUs") and average revenue per user ("ARPU").

A "non-GAAP financial measure" refers to a numerical measure of our historical or future financial performance or financial position that is included in (or excluded from) the most directly comparable measure calculated and presented in accordance with GAAP in our financial statements. We provide certain non-GAAP measures as additional information relating to our operating results as a complement to results provided in accordance with GAAP. The non-GAAP financial information presented herein should be considered in conjunction with, and not as a substitute for or superior to, the financial information presented in accordance with GAAP and should not be considered a measure of liquidity. There are significant limitations associated with the use of non-GAAP financial measures. Further, these measures may differ from the non-GAAP information, even where similarly titled, used by other companies and therefore should not be used to compare our performance to that of other companies.

We have presented billings, adjusted contribution, adjusted EBITDA, adjusted FI Share and other third party costs, non-GAAP net income (loss) and non-GAAP net income (loss) per share as non-GAAP financial measures in this press release. Billings represents the gross amount billed to marketers for advertising campaigns in order to generate revenue. Billings is reported gross of both Consumer Incentives and FI Share. Our GAAP revenue is recognized net of Consumer Incentives and gross of FI Share. We define adjusted contribution as a measure by which revenue generated from our marketers exceeds the cost to obtain the purchase data and the digital advertising space from our FI partners. Adjusted contribution demonstrates how incremental marketing spend on our platform generates incremental amounts to support our sales and marketing, research and development, general and administration and other investments. Adjusted contribution is calculated by taking our total revenue less our FI Share and other third party costs exclusive of a non-cash equity expense and amortization of deferred FI implementation costs, which are non-cash costs. Adjusted contribution does not take into account all costs associated with generating revenue from advertising campaigns, including sales and marketing expenses, research and development expenses, general and administrative expenses and other expenses, which we do not take into consideration when making decisions on how to manage our advertising campaigns. We define adjusted EBITDA as our net loss before income tax benefit; interest expense, net; depreciation and amortization expense; stock-based compensation expense; foreign currency loss; amortization of deferred FI implementation costs; costs associated with financing events; loss on extinguishment of debt; change in fair value of warrant liabilities; and a non-cash equity expense recognized in FI Share. We define adjusted FI Share and other third-party costs as our FI Share and other third-party costs excluding non-cash equity expense and amortization of deferred FI implementation costs. We define non-GAAP net income (loss) as our net loss before stock-based compensation expense; foreign currency loss; costs associated with financing events; loss on extinguishment of debt; change in fair value of warrant liabilities; and a non-cash equity expense recognized in FI Share. Notably, any impacts related to minimum FI Share commitments in connection with agreements with certain FI partners are not added back to net loss in order to calculate adjusted EBITDA, adjusted contribution and non-GAAP net income (loss). We define non-GAAP net income (loss) per share as non-GAAP net income (loss) divided by non-GAAP weighted-average common shares outstanding, basic and diluted, which includes our GAAP weighted-average common shares outstanding, basic and diluted, and our weighted-average preferred shares outstanding, assuming conversion.

We believe the use of non-GAAP financial measures, as a supplement to GAAP measures, is useful to investors in that they eliminate items that are either not part of our core operations or do not require a cash outlay, such as stock-based compensation expense. Management uses these non-GAAP financial measures when evaluating operating performance and for internal planning and forecasting purposes. We believe that these non-GAAP financial measures help indicate underlying trends in the business, are important in comparing current results with prior period results, and are useful to investors and financial analysts in assessing operating performance.

We define FI MAUs as targetable customers or accounts of our FI partners that logged in and visited the online or mobile banking applications of, or opened an email containing our offers from, our FI partners during a monthly period. We then calculate a monthly average of these FI MAUs for the periods presented. We define ARPU as the total Cardlytics Direct revenue generated in the applicable period calculated in accordance with GAAP, divided by the average number of FI MAUs in the applicable period.
